What do Mountain Reedbucks look like?

Mountain Reedbucks have a brownish-grey coat with a white underbelly. They have a short, bushy tail and small, straight horns on their heads. They are about 80 to 100 centimeters tall and weigh between 35 and 65 kilograms.
